For new team members: the reindex is throttled deliberately, and these limits exist because unthrottled runs have twice saturated the storage tier. Before adjusting anything, read the runbook and confirm the export schedule hasn't moved. Owner for this item is the Meridale platform rotation. The throttle constants currently in effect are listed below.

limits module of fajog-tawig:
RATE_LIMITS = {
    "druwyn": 2,
    "quenael": 10,
    "wenix": 2,
    "druael": 2,
}

## Account Recovery — Trailnote Offline Mode

When a surveyor's Trailnote app has been offline for 30+ days, their local credentials expire and sync refuses to resume. Don't make them wipe the device — all their unsynced field data lives there! Instead, open the support console, pick "Offline Reinstate," and enter their handle. The console will ask for the support team's shared recovery passphrase before issuing a reinstatement token. Use the one below.

unlock words, bagaf-fajeg: zorael-kelax-fraath-quenix-eliok-sileth-aldmir-wenir-druiel

## Authentication

Nightflow, our scheduler for nightly data backfills, authenticates to the internal Chronos job registry on startup. Reviewers should confirm that no credentials are read from flags or committed config; the only supported path is the secrets mount at `/etc/nightflow/auth`. Local integration tests stub the registry, but end-to-end runs against staging require a real token, supplied below.

service key, fawip-bajef: kto11_Qt5wZK9vdNC